Do
always use a fireguard complying with BS 8423 for the protection of young
children, the elderly, the infirm or pet animals. The cast iron top, front, rear and sides
of this stove are considered to be working surfaces and so will become very hot when
in use. Always take care when using this appliance.
Do
wait three minutes before attempting to relight if the gas stove is switched off or
the flames are extinguished for any reason (Your gas stove is fitted with a safety
device that will automatically shut off the gas supply to the gas stove, if for any
reason, the flame goes out. If this operates then wait at least ten minutes before
operating the stove).
Do
get advice about the suitability of any wall covering near your gas stove. Soft wall
coverings (e.g. embossed vinyl, etc.) which have a raised pattern are easily affected
by heat. They may, therefore, scorch or become discoloured when close to a heating
appliance. Please bear this in mind whenever you are considering redecorating.
Don’t use this stove with the door open or with the glass panel damaged or
removed. The door should always be secured shut (See “Cleaning your stove”).
If the window is damaged or will not close securely the stove must be turned
off and not used until the window is changed or corrected by a competent
service engineer.
Don’t
hang clothing, towels or any other fabrics over the gas stove.
